Of course I just bought Blasphemous last month...

Last time I played Soulcalibur was IV... If VI is decent SP I might pick it up.
Actually has a decent sp which is like an rpg mode with a map to tackle quests and a story that progresses. Also simpler 'character' stories that are generally just one battle after another with some talking heads explaining the story. It's definetly one of the better sp's out of current fighting games if not the best(mostly due to how poor the competition is in this regard).
